Want to run an online store but don’t want to handle inventory? Dropshipping might be your ideal business idea for women. In this model, you sell products through an e-commerce platform, but a third-party supplier fulfills the orders.
The startup cost is low, and the risk is minimal. Your focus is on product selection, customer service, and marketing. Shopify, Oberlo, and Spocket are popular tools for setting up your store.
This model is especially appealing for first-time female entrepreneurs who want to test ideas without large investments. It’s a prime example of a low-investment business that can become highly profitable when executed well.

Creating and selling digital products is a powerful and passive-income-friendly business idea for women. Unlike physical goods, digital products have no inventory, shipping, or production costs—meaning higher profit margins. Whether it’s ebooks, templates, digital planners, or online courses, digital goods serve an audience’s needs while freeing up your time.
This model works exceptionally well for educators, creatives, and service providers. For example, a fitness coach might sell a workout guide; a graphic designer might offer branding templates; or a therapist might publish a mental health journal. Each of these is a small business idea that scales with automation tools like Gumroad, Etsy, or your own e-commerce website.
